﻿.container {width:1200px;margin:0 auto}
.btn {width:53px! important;height:25px! important;background:#c6c6c6;color: #fff;border-radius: 0;padding:2px 0;margin-left: 10px;}
.logobg {background: ;height:163px;position: relative;}
.logo {margin-left:18px;margin-top: 49px;width:94px;}
.logoname {margin-left:10px;margin-top: 65px;width:715px;color: #3e3a39;}
.logoname .cn{font-size: 28px;font-weight: 700;display: block;font-family:黑体;}
.logoname .en{font-size: 15px;font-family: arial;font-weight: 700;display: block;margin-top: 10px;}
.bg {background:  no-repeat;}
.bgs {background: #fff;}
.searchss {position: relative;margin-top:97px;margin-right:22px ;}  
.searchs {width:260px;height:35px;border:1px solid #c7c7c7;padding-left:10px;color:#c7c7c7;line-height:35px}
.submits {position:absolute;border: 1px solid transparent;background:  no-repeat;width:17px; height:17px;right:10px ;bottom:10px}
.logobg .old_a{position:absolute;right: 25px;top:20px;color: #333;text-decoration: underline;}

.navbg { background: #1e91d6;padding:0 40px;line-height: 50px;}
.nav { line-height: 50px;position: relative;height:50px;position:relative;z-index:2}
.navi{position:absolute;height:15px;border-left: 1px solid #fff;display:inline-block;left: 0px;top: 18px;}
.nav li {float:left;text-align: center;margin: 0 auto;width:139px;position: relative;text-align: center;}
.nav li i{position:absolute;height:15px;border-right: 1px solid #fff;display:inline-block;right: 0;top: 18px;}
.nav li a {color:#fff ;font-size: 16px;text-align: center;font-weight: 700;padding:0! important;display: block;}
.nav li:hover a {color: #6c08aa;text-decoration:none;background: transparent;}
.nav > li.active > a, .nav > li.active > a:focus, .nav > li.active > a:hover{color: #6c08aa;text-decoration:none;background: transparent;}
.nav li:active a {color: #6c08aa;text-decoration:none;background: transparent;}



.nav li ul li {font-size:14px;color:#fff;text-align: center;height: 20px;background:#1e91d6;height:37px;line-height:37px;margin-top:1px}
.nav li ul li a {font-size:14px! important;color:#fff! important;height:37px;line-height:37px;}
.address li {float:left}
.navs { position: absolute;display:none; width: 100%; z-index: 9;;top:50px;left:0}
.nav li ul li:hover {background:#6c08aa! important;;}


.footer {height:100px;margin-top: 30px;border-top: 1px solid #e0e0e0;}
.foots {width:1154px;margin:0 auto;padding-top: 30px;}
.foots a {font-size: 12px; color: #3e3a39;}
.foots div{font-size: 12px; color: #3e3a39;line-height: 25px;}
.footimg {width:67px;height:67px;}
.footimg img {width: 100%;height:100%}



ol, ul {margin-bottom: 0;}
.col-lg-1, .col-lg-10, .col-lg-11, .col-lg-12, .col-lg-2, .col-lg-3, .col-lg-4, .col-lg-5, .col-lg-6, .col-lg-7, .col-lg-8, .col-lg-9, .col-md-1, .col-md-10, .col-md-11, .col-md-12, .col-md-2, .col-md-3, .col-md-4, .col-md-5, .col-md-6, .col-md-7, .col-md-8, .col-md-9, .col-sm-1, .col-sm-10, .col-sm-11, .col-sm-12, .col-sm-2, .col-sm-3, .col-sm-4, .col-sm-5, .col-sm-6, .col-sm-7, .col-sm-8, .col-sm-9, .col-xs-1, .col-xs-10, .col-xs-11, .col-xs-12, .col-xs-2, .col-xs-3, .col-xs-4, .col-xs-5, .col-xs-6, .col-xs-7, .col-xs-8, .col-xs-9{padding-left: 0;padding-right: 0;}
















